Our Secondary Partners

We benefit from a variety of partner schools in west London as well as across London more widely.

 

Brentside High SchoolBrentside High School: A large mixed 11-18 secondary school in the heart of Ealing, with 1700 pupils including a thriving sixth form

Chiswick SchoolChiswick School: An 11-18 academy nestled in the heart of leafy Chiswick, with over 1,500 pupils, including a thriving and successful sixth form

Heston Community SchoolHeston Community School: An 11-18 mixed academy with 1300 pupils, in the heart of Hounslow

Isleworth & Syon SchoolIsleworth & Syon School: A boys secondary school, with mixed sixth form, in Hounslow with a rich history of education in the area dating back 400 years

Lampton SchoolLampton School: An Ofsted Outstanding (2024) 11-18 school in central Hounslow, with over 1500 pupils on roll including a large sixth form of +300 students

Marylebone BoysMarylebone Boys’ School: A boys 11-16 school uniquely located in the thriving central London borough of Westminster

The Healthland SchoolThe Heathland School: A large 11-18 comprehensive school in Hounslow, with over 1800 pupils, rated Outstanding by Ofsted in 2024

The Green School for BoysThe Green School for Boys: An 11-18 boys Church of England comprehensive school in Isleworth with a long-standing history, and a mixed sixth form, shared with The Green School for Girls

The Green School for GirlsThe Green School for Girls: An 11-18 girls Church of England comprehensive school in Isleworth with a long-standing history, and a mixed sixth form, shared with The Green School for Boys

Tiffin SchoolTiffin School: A large state boys grammar school based in Kingston, with a legacy dating back to 1638, currently has 1500 pupils on roll with a co-educational sixth form
